Internal memo — Records team. A pallet of recalled Nimbus-7 chargers ships out Friday via Stoneway Carriers. Please pull all intake and recall correspondence for the batch and place copies in the dispatch folder by Thursday noon. Originals stay on file. The courier hand-over must follow the confidential instruction below.

dispatch memo: the julix druius courier leaves the olimir istwyn rusdor ledger at gate 7121 under passcode 173660

## Sensor drift: what to do at 3am

If the GrowLoop controller starts reporting humidity swings that don't match the backup probes in the Fernwick greenhouse, it's almost always sensor drift, not an actual climate event. Don't panic and don't touch the vents manually. First, restart the calibration daemon and give it ten minutes to re-baseline. If readings still disagree by more than 5%, flip the controller into safe mode. The safe-mode thresholds it will use are these.

config for yahap-bajof:
[istix]
host = istix.qorvelsys.internal
user = istix_svc
database = istix_prod

/*
 * Linter client setup for SQLGroom plugins.
 *
 * Plugin authors: rules run against parsed SQL files only — no
 * raw-text hooks. Register rules via registerRule() before init.
 * Built-in rules (naming, keyword case, no SELECT *) always run
 * first; your rules run in registration order. Violations must
 * return a span and a fixable flag. Rule metadata is fetched from
 * the Groomhub registry at startup, which requires an authenticated
 * client. Initialize the registry client with the key below.
 */

app token of yajeg-kawef = kto11_7En3XSX8xQw